La Casa Di Emanuela Apartment
Set in the Esquilino district of Rome, approximately 25 minutes' walk from the walled Giardino degli Aranci Park, the 2-room La Casa Di Emanuela Apartment Rome accommodates up to 4 guests. Wi-Fi is provided for both business and leisure activities.
Location
This apartment offers a convenient setting, a mere 0.6 miles from Roma Termini train station and within easy reach of Piazza Vittorio Emanuele II. The 59 ft² La Casa Di Emanuela Apartment is located around 30 minutes by foot from Palatine Hill and merely 7 minutes by foot from Scala Sancta Sanctuary. The apartment is 1.5 miles from Pantheon Temple.
Rooms
The accommodation offers a seating area with views of the town and comforts like climate control. La Casa Di Emanuela Apartment offers guests the convenient feature of a hair dryer, dressing gowns, and a shower cap in the bathroom. Furthermore, a bidet, a walk-in shower, and a separate toilet is available.
Food & Drinks
A kitchenette with an electric kettle, coffee and tea making machines, and a kitchenware is available as part of this apartment's self-catering amenities. Offering access to the rest of Rome, Manzoni subway station is about a 5-minute walk away.
